Bang Bang Salmon Recipe

Description

This Bang Bang Salmon is a flavorful and easy dish that’s ready in under 30 minutes! Crispy air-fried salmon bites are coated in a creamy, sweet, and spicy Bang Bang sauce. It’s a delicious and healthy meal that’s perfect for a weeknight dinner or a casual appetizer.


Ingredients

  • Salmon Bites:

    • 1 1/2 pounds salmon fillets, skin removed and cut into bite-sized pieces
    • 1 tablespoon olive oil
    •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
    • 1 teaspoon onion powder
    •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
    • 1/2 teaspoon salt
    •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
    • 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ional, for extra heat)
  • Bang Bang Sauce:

    • 1/2 cup mayonnaise
    • 1/4 cup Thai sweet chili sauce
    • 1 tablespoon sriracha sauce (adjust to taste)
    • 1 tablespoon honey
    • 1 tablespoon lime juice

Instructions

  1. Make Bang Bang Sauce: In a small bowl, whisk together mayonnaise, sweet chili sauce, sriracha, honey, and lime juice. Set aside.
  2. Season Salmon: In a large bowl, combine salmon bites with olive oil, garlic powder, onion powder, smoked paprika, salt, pepper, and cayenne pepper (if using). Toss to coat.
  3. Air Fry: Preheat air fryer to 400°F (200°C). Place salmon bites in a single layer in the air fryer basket and cook for 8-10 minutes, shaking the basket halfway through, until crispy.
  4. Serve: Transfer salmon bites to a serving platter. Drizzle with Bang Bang sauce and serve with extra sauce on the side for dipping.

Notes

  • Use fresh salmon fillets without skin for optimal results.
  • Adjust the amount of sriracha in the sauce to control the heat level.
  • Cook salmon bites in a single layer to ensure crispiness.
  • Drizzle the sauce over the salmon just before serving to maintain crispiness.
  • Store leftovers in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
  • Freeze cooked salmon bites in a single layer before transferring to a freezer-safe container for longer storage.
